Action item from the TumbleNest locker outage: the access flow retried door-unlock commands forever when the gateway at the Ferndale Commons site went dark, which drained batteries on three lockers. Owner is the access-flow squad; due before next sprint review. Fix is capped retries plus exponential backoff and a battery-aware circuit breaker. For the sync, here are the constants we're proposing to ship:

constants for bawif-kawif:
QUOTAS = {
    "ulaael": 5,
    "holael": 10,
}

Lanternquay renders dates per-locale in all three environments, but the localization tables are loaded differently in each. Staging pulls locale bundles from the shared artifact store, while production pins a vetted snapshot — reviewers should confirm the snapshot hash matches the approved release, since a tampered bundle could alter displayed transaction dates. Sandbox allows unsigned bundles for testing only; this is intentional and documented. Each environment's localization behavior is governed by the configuration block that follows:

deployment values, yadug-bawif:
[framir]
team = pelox
access_code = ac_a38ab2
owner = tamion.julael
host = framir.tolvaqlabs.test
port = 11211
peer = tammir.zemvargrid.local
salt = 2215ef03
pin = 1541

Subject: Heads up — key rotation for Cartwheel load tests

Hi plugin folks,

Quick one: we're rotating the key that the Cartwheel load-testing harness uses to hit our internal checkout sandbox. If your plugin drives synthetic checkout runs, swap the key before Friday or your runs will start 401-ing mid-flow (annoying, we know). Nothing else changes — same endpoints, same rate limits, same fake shoppers. Update your harness config and rerun a smoke test. New key is right below.

API key for tagef-fafop: vxb2-ta

# Break-Glass Access — Telemetry Compression Service

For the weekly sync: if the Quillgate compressor stalls and payload backlogs exceed an hour, break-glass access lets you bypass the codec gateway and flush uncompressed batches. Use only after paging the owner twice. Access to the emergency console requires the recovery passphrase shown below.

strongbox words: zorwyn-sorael-belion-ulaius-silmir-ulays-briax-rusdor-gorix